What Are My Financial Goals and Needs?
Before looking outward, start by looking inward. Understanding your financial goals, needs, and the complexity of your financial situation is paramount. Are you seeking comprehensive wealth management, specific advice on investment, retirement planning, or perhaps guidance on philanthropic endeavors? Establishing clear objectives will help you determine the type of wealth management service you require.

What Is Their Level of Transparency?
Transparency in fees, investment strategies, and ongoing communication is critical in a wealth management partnership. Understanding how a firm communicates with its clients, how often portfolios are reviewed, and how they report performance can provide insights into the firm’s transparency and client service commitment.

What Is Their Client Service Model?
The structure of client service and support is a crucial factor in choosing a wealth manager. Consider the accessibility of your advisor, the frequency of reviews and updates, and the responsiveness of the firm to your inquiries. A firm that prioritizes client relationships and offers dedicated support aligns more closely with the interests of their clients.
